Order Entry Specialist, Bilingual (French and English)

**Description: - Permanent Full Time- Reporting to the Assistant Manager of Administration, you will be responsible for accurate and timely processing of financial and non-financial transactions for our clients' mutual fund accounts in support of our distribution partners.
What you will do

  • Processing complex transactions to mutual fund accounts
  • Reviewing transactions entered by advisors
  • Communicating with advisors' requirements to turn "not in good order" trades into "in good order" trades
  • Understanding the mutual fund industry, regulatory guidelines, Quadrus and fund company business processes
  • Tracking and reporting activity
  • Meeting service standards to minimize financial impact

What you will bring

  • Bilingual in French and English is a requirement.
  • Completion of the IFIC Operations and/ or Investment Funds Course is an asset
  • Previous experience in a role communicating with Advisors is an asset
  • Working knowledge of the mutual fund industry, regulatory guidelines and Quadrus & fund company business processes is an asset
  • Excellent written communication skills
  • Attention to detail
  • Team player committed to achieving team objectives
  • Selfmotivated and enjoy a busy work environment
  • Ability to meet strict daily deadlines
  • Ability to organize and prioritize daily responsibilities
